Page 2 sur 2

Re: Recettes sur Vijeo-designer.

Posté : 25 nov. 2015, 03:09
par itasoft
slts,
""je vois bien les recettes défiler à toute allure et le tableau se remplir""

tu sélectionne une recette à chaque tour de cycle je présume ?
(car si tu fais ça avec une boucle dans le même tour de cycle, ça peut pas marcher).
a suivre

Re: Recettes sur Vijeo-designer.

Posté : 25 nov. 2015, 07:31
par steph68
tu sélectionne une recette à chaque tour de cycle je présume ?
il n'y a pas de boucle dans les scripts (sauf sur celui de la recherche).
à chaque fin de contrat (à la fin d'un chargement) je lance le contrat suivant.

@+

Re: Recettes sur Vijeo-designer.

Posté : 25 nov. 2015, 07:58
par steph68
bon ben c'est mort.

il n'est pas possible de charger une recette depuis un script au démarrage de l'IHM.

j'ai réussi à positionner une recette au démarrage seulement en passant par un autre script.
c'est à dire, au démarrage, on place une variable booléen "BOOT" à 1.
et un script réagit lorsque "BOOT" passe à 1.

dans ce cas, j'arrive à charger la recette mais le script "écouteur" n'est pas appelé :evil:
le hic, c'est que de temps en temps, ça s'arrête en plein milieu (le gestionnaire de recettes doit retourner une erreur ou je ne sais quoi ...) - un coup c'est nickel, un coup ça plante au bout de X recettes traitées ...
en poussant un peu le debug, c'est le script "écouteur" qui de temps en temps n'est plus appelé (l'arrêt est complétement aléatoire).
donc c'est les évènements de Vijeo qui sont moisis :evil: et ça ne marchera jamais correctement ...

donc fin de l'histoire, n'utilisez pas Vijeo c'est buggé à mort :mrgreen:

@+

Re: Recettes sur Vijeo-designer.

Posté : 25 nov. 2015, 08:25
par steph68
juste pour essayer, j'ai changé la variable surveillée (la condition de déclenchement) du script "écouteur"

j'ai choisis "_RecipeControlDefault.Operation" plutôt que la variable "Status" et du coup tout fonctionne miraculeusement ... (je garantis pas le 100%, mais ça à l'air d'être pas mal)

@+